
Five surgeons from big cities are discussing who makes the best
patients to operate on.
The first surgeon, from New York, says:
- 'I like to see accountants on my operating table because when you open them up, everything inside is numbered.'
The second, from Chicago, responds:
- 'Yeah, but you should try electricians! Everything inside them is color coded.'
The third surgeon, from Dallas, says:
- 'No, I really think librarians are the best, everything inside them is in alphabetical order.'
The fourth surgeon, from Los Angeles, chimes in:
- 'You know, I like construction workers...Those guys always understand when you have a few parts left over.'
But the fifth surgeon, from Washington D.C., shut them all up when he observed:
- 'You're all wrong. Politicians are the easiest to operate on. There's no guts, no heart, no balls, no brains, and no spine...Plus, the head and the ass are interchangeable.'
